Automatic Weight Control Systems
One of the most notable features of advanced sachet packaging machines is the automatic weight control system. This system ensures that each sachet is filled to the exact weight required. It uses sensors and algorithms to monitor and adjust the weight in real-time, reducing waste and ensuring consistency. Real-Time Monitoring
Modern sachet packaging machines are equipped with real-time monitoring features that provide a comprehensive overview of the packaging process. This allows operators to track the process from start to finish, ensuring that everything runs smoothly. By identifying and addressing issues early, these machines help maintain high product quality. Integrated Quality Control Mechanisms
Integrated quality control mechanisms are another key feature of advanced sachet packaging machines. These sensors detect any defects in the packaging process, such as bubbles or torn seals, and alert the operator to take corrective action. Machine learning algorithms can even analyze past data to optimize the packaging process further. Automation and Artificial Intelligence
The future of sachet packaging machines is promising, with advancements in automation and artificial intelligence (AI). These technologies will allow machines to operate even more autonomously, reducing the need for human intervention. AI can also be used to optimize the packaging process, taking into account factors like product weight, packaging material, and environmental impact. For example, AI can predict machine failures and proactively adjust the packaging process to prevent downtime.
Internet of Things (IoT) Integration
Another emerging trend is the use of the Internet of Things (IoT) in sachet packaging machines. By connecting machines to a network, manufacturers can monitor and control their operations from a central location. This allows for greater flexibility and efficiency, as machines can be adjusted and optimized in real-time. Additionally, IoT enables machines to share data with other systems, such as inventory management and quality control, creating a seamless workflow.
Sustainability Features
Sustainability is also a key area of focus for future advancements in sachet packaging machines. Many companies are looking to reduce the environmental impact of packaging by using biodegradable materials and minimizing waste. Advanced machines can be designed to use sustainable materials and energy-efficient processes, contributing to a more environmentally friendly packaging industry.
